How Our Team Removes Water from Broken Pipes

With Broken Pipe Water Removal, a proper process is crucial. Our team uses a systematic approach to ensure every step is taken to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ll assess the damage, extract the water, and dry your space using specialized equipment.

Assessment and Containment

We’ll quickly assess the situation to find out the extent of the damage. Our technicians will contain the affected area to prevent further water spread and ensure a safe working environment.

Water Extraction

Using powerful pumps and wet vacuums, we’ll extract as much water as possible from your property.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ing drying time.

Moisture Detection and Drying

We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ture pockets and dry your property thoroughly.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your space is safe to occupy.

Sanitizing and Dehumidification

Our team will sanitize your property to remove any bacteria or mold growth. We’ll also deploy dehumidifiers to maintain a safe humidity level and prevent future issues.

Final Inspection and Verification

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is completely dry and safe. Our technicians will verify that all equipment is removed, and your space is ready for occupancy.

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following warning signs, as they can show a broken pipe or water damage in your home.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ice a strong, unpleasant odor in your home, it’s time to investigate further.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can appear on your ceiling or walls due to a leaky pipe or roof damage. If you notice these stains,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or a hidden leak. If you notice your flooring is uneven or damaged, it’s time to call our team.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ds, such as dripping or gurgling noises, can show a leaky pipe or water damage. If you notice these sounds, it’s essential to investigate further.

Visible Water Damage or Puddles

Visible water damage or puddles on your floor or ceiling can be a sign of a broken pipe or water leak. If you notice these signs, don’t hesitate to call our team.

Increased Water Bills

An unexpected increase in your water bills can show a hidden leak or water damage.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s time to investigate further.
